On Friday 12th January 2018, our nursery classes had an amazing treat as they were visited by a few members of the London Fire Brigade. The children’s eyes lit up as they see the enormous red truck pull into the playground!
The children all had the opportunity to sit in the truck, look at the many tools that are used by the Firefighters to tackle fires and other callouts. They also were lucky enough to use the hoses and really get a feel for what its like to tackle a blaze as a firefighter in London.
As part of the learning topic “Understanding the world”, the nursery classes got a glimpse of how the role of a Firefighter is so important to our local community. It is an invaluable job and vital for the people of London and towns across the country. The nursery have a fire house of their own, which they were very happy to showcase to their visitors. The fire team were very impressed.
